Output 691e9defe4c69c907f631d43537bc1eeec87fefc169b2e85ec42cd76d48d476a:19

value
80644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8048507ce72516c6f4ca521d2ae981ea1c72517b OP_EQUAL
address
3DPK3bEZ5oShzTvWWw5XzLV6vXbUXFZQXz
transaction
691e9defe4c69c907f631d43537bc1eeec87fefc169b2e85ec42cd76d48d476a
spent
true